Enhancing Workplace Safety Through Safesense Real-Time Reporting Technology

Abstract

In a real-time monitoring and alerting system that detects temperature, gas, and smoke levels for remote notifications in emergency scenarios faces challenges in sending alerts on time and monitoring local premises. This project aims to design a real-time monitoring and safety system that detects temperature, harmful gas, and smoke levels while activating suction fans for ventilation and sending alerts via a GSM module for timely intervention. The system incorporates DS18B20 (temperature sensor), MQ-series (gas sensor), and a smoke sensor, alongside a GSM module (e.g., SIM800L) for communication and suction fans controlled by a microcontroller (e.g., Arduino). The system monitors environmental parameters, activates suction fans to reduce hazardous conditions when thresholds are exceeded, and sends SMS alerts via the GSM module to predefined mobile numbers for timely action.
